On Thursday 16 July 2009 11:52:26 am Mike Mabey wrote: > Hi All, > > I have a question about manually setting the value of a dCheckBox. It > doesn't specify in the API > Documentation<http://paul.dabodev.com/doc/api/dabodoc/dabo.ui.uiwx.dCheckBo >x.dCheckBox.html#Properties_Value>whether this property is read/write at > runtime or not, though I assume it > is, just like all the other data controls. In my app, I have been unable > to set this property at all, and I was wondering if there's something I > should know concerning setting this particular property. > > In case you need more detail about my specific project, I'm running Win > Vista with Python 2.5.4 with Dabo r5279. I've developed this app in the > ClassDesigner. I'm trying to set the value in the afterInitAll() method of > dForm with a 1 or 0 for True/False, but never reflects the given value and > doesn't give an error. It wouldn't make sense to try binding this field to > a data set since there's no associated database, just a configuration file > I wrote myself with values in it for each of the data controls. > > Any help would be very appreciated, > Mike M.
Show us the code that sets the value. Make sure you are using "Value" and not 'value'. Also make sure you haven't set the 'UserThreeState'.
